Commercial roof inspection services involve a thorough evaluation of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ential problems. These inspections typically include examining the roof's surface, flashing, drainage systems, and structural components to assess their condition and functionality. The goal is to detect signs of damage, wear, or deterioration that could compromise the roof’s integrity, helping property owners plan necessary repairs or maintenance before issues escalate. Regular inspections can also assist in documenting the roof’s condition over time, which is valuable for insurance purposes or future planning.
This service helps address common roofing problems such as leaks, ponding water, damaged flashing, or compromised membrane layers. By identifying these issues early, property owners can prevent costly repairs, reduce the risk of water intrusion, and extend the lifespan of the roof. Inspections can also reveal underlying problems like structural weaknesses or material degradation that may not be immediately visible. Addressing these concerns proactively ensures the safety and durability of the building, minimizing disruptions caused by unexpected roof failures.

What is included in a commercial roof inspection? A commercial roof inspection typically involves a thorough assessment of the roof's surface, drainage systems, flashing, and overall structural condition to identify potential issues.
How often should a commercial roof be inspected? It is generally recommended to have a commercial roof inspected at least once a year or after significant weather events to ensure proper maintenance and early detection of problems.
What are common issues found during commercial roof inspections? Common issues include membrane damage, ponding water, damaged flashing, membrane blisters, and signs of wear or aging that could lead to leaks or structural concerns.
Can a commercial roof inspection help prevent costly repairs? Yes, regular inspections can identify minor problems early, allowing for timely repairs that may help avoid more extensive and costly damage later.
